Journal of Teaching and Learning for Graduate Employability is an academic journal published by Deakin University (Australia). Identifiers: eISSN 1838-3815. Indexed in SCOPUS. Metrics: CiteScore 3.5, SJR 0.458, SNIP 1.05. tlooto lists 140 papers from this journal.
